MySQL教程:从入门到精通,助力网站开发知识提升

MySQL教程:从入门到精通,助力网站开发知识提升

在当今的数字化时代,数据库技术已成为网站和应用程序开发不可或缺的一部分。MySQL,作为最流行的开源关系型数据库管理系统之一,广泛应用于各类网站和项目中。本篇MySQL教程旨在帮助初学者从零开始,逐步掌握MySQL的核心知识,进而提升网站开发能力。

首先,我们要了解MySQL的基本概念和特点。MySQL是一个多用户、多线程的SQL数据库服务器,它提供了丰富的数据类型、强大的数据操作功能和灵活的数据检索方式。无论是小型项目还是大型企业级应用,MySQL都能提供稳定可靠的数据存储解决方案。

接下来,我们将通过几个步骤,带领大家走进MySQL的世界:

1. **安装与配置MySQL**:
– 从MySQL官方网站下载安装包,根据操作系统选择合适的版本。
– 安装过程中,设置root用户的密码,并牢记。
– 配置MySQL服务,确保服务能够随系统启动而自动运行。

2. **学习SQL基础**:
– 掌握SELECT、INSERT、UPDATE和DELETE等基本SQL语句。
– 学习如何使用JOIN进行多表查询,以及如何使用子查询和聚合函数。
– 理解事务的概念,学会使用COMMIT和ROLLBACK来管理事务。

3. **创建和管理数据库与表**:
– 使用CREATE DATABASE和DROP DATABASE语句来创建和删除数据库。
– 学习如何使用CREATE TABLE和ALTER TABLE来定义和修改表结构。
– 掌握如何设置主键、外键和索引,以优化数据检索性能。

4. **数据备份与恢复**:
– 学习使用mysqldump工具进行数据库的备份。
– 掌握如何从备份文件中恢复数据库。

5. **优化与性能调优**:
– 了解如何对MySQL进行性能调优,包括查询优化和索引优化。
– 学习如何监控MySQL的性能指标,如查询速度、内存使用等。

6. **结合网站开发**:
– 掌握如何在网站开发中使用MySQL,包括连接数据库、执行SQL语句和处理查询结果。
– 学习如何将MySQL与PHP等后端语言结合使用,实现数据的动态展示与处理。

通过学习本MySQL教程,你将不仅掌握数据库管理的基本技能,还能将这些技能应用于实际的网站开发项目中。无论是构建个人博客、电子商务网站,还是开发企业级应用,MySQL都将是你的得力助手。

为了帮助你更好地学习和实践MySQL,我们推荐你访问我们的「网站开发知识」专栏,那里有更多关于MySQL的深入教程和实例分析。同时,如果你想进一步提升后端开发能力,不妨考虑参加我们的「PHP在线课」,课程中将涵盖PHP与MySQL的实战应用,助你成为全能的后端开发工程师。

0

评论0

请先 登录

没有账号? 忘记密码?